Players who can watch the table tennis 2025 World Championships

Chinese players or couples have won 13 of the last 15 men -Singles, 22 of the last 23 women -Singles, 14 of the last 16 doubles of men, 22 of the last 23 women -double and 19 (and half) of the last 23 mixed mix titles.

However, her gripping for the title of men – now without the Olympic champion Ma Long and the fan Zhendong – may not be as safe as it seems. With Calderano's victory in Macau this year and the two world number two concludes Wang In the semi -finals and the world number one Lin Shidong In the final, the Chasing Pack has never had a better signal that the title could be torn down.

Calderano, the world number three; Japan Harimoto TomokazuFourth in the world; French brothers Félix Lebrun (Sixth) and Alexis Lebrun (ninth); Truls Möregårdh of Sweden (seventh); and Germany Patrick Franziska (Seventh) and Dang Qiu (10th) form a strong challenging field with fifth place Liang Jingkun The only other Chinese player in the top 15 seeds in Doha.

The women -Singles event looks much easier on paper, with the four best seeds Chinese. The top 10 seeds are all Asian, with Japanese Harimoto Miwa (fifth), Hayata Hina (sixth), Odo Satsuki (seventh), Ito Mima (eighth); Republic of Koreas Shin Yubin (ninth); and Chinese Taipeiis Cheng i-Ching (10.) Provision of the main competitions for the Chinese: SunPresent Wang manyuPresent Chen xingongAnd Wang Yidi.
